After-hours access to the server room at Dornfield Systems is restricted to pre-approved technicians listed on the nightly roster kept at reception. Verify photo identification against the roster before admitting anyone, and log the entry time in the access book. Visitors may never be left unescorted in the corridor leading to the server room, and the fire door must remain closed at all times. If a roster-approved technician arrives without their own badge, issue the loaner badge and provide the following door code.

badge for fafop-fajof: bdg-Z-47

## Changelog — PortionWise 2.9.0: Signing Key Rotation

Plugin authors: the key used to sign PortionWise core and the plugin SDK has been rotated following our annual schedule. Plugins signed against the old key will continue to load until 2.11.0, after which verification becomes strict. Please re-verify your build pipelines and update any pinned fingerprints before then. The scaling-engine API is unchanged. The new public verification key is published below.

deploy key for kajof-fajop: bky6_gDHw9Q

### v4.2.0 — Changed defaults

The Murkvale event schema registry now rejects unversioned schemas by default and enforces backward compatibility on every subject. Contractors onboarding this week: existing pipelines were migrated automatically, but any local tooling must be updated. Compatibility mode can still be relaxed per subject via the admin API. The registry ships with these defaults.

deployment values, yahag-tawef:
ZORWYN_HOST=zorwyn.tolvaqlabs.internal
ZORWYN_PORT=9300

Ticket: Fuelscope vault locked after three failed unlocks. The monthly fleet fuel-usage report for the Harrowfen depot cannot be generated until the vault is reopened. Auto-lock triggered during last night's maintenance window; no data loss expected. Support can unlock via the recovery flow in the admin console. Enter the recovery passphrase noted directly below this line.

strongbox words: zoreth-fraox-oliius-aldeth-jorax-praeth-holmir-drumir-prawyn